A profile study of body composition of college educators
Author(s): Dr. Dadasaheb B Dhengale
Abstract:
Physical fitness is important concept of human being in daily life. The body composition is one of the major components of health related physical fitness. It is related with the most common health issues. The purpose of this study was to investigate the fat% of college educators. Participants were 84 (Male 50 & Female 34) College educators aged between 25-55 years old were selected by using convenience sampling technique. Omron Fat Monitor was used to assess the fat% of college educators. The assessment was undertaken within the instruction of the tool developer. Further the data was analysis with help of descriptive statistics i.e. Mean, Standard Deviation & Percentile. Result shows that the 68% male & female were found in high fat% Category.
